syncdb不为嵌套模型创建表

2024-09-28 01:24:45 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一个Django项目,模型结构如下:

my_model/
├── __init__.py
├── models/
    ├── __init__.py
    ├── my_model.py
    ├── my_other_model.py

我的_模型.py还有我的其他_模型.py每个都包含一个model、MyModel和MyOtherModel,在我的Django设置文件中,我将这个文件夹添加到我的已安装应用程序列表中,如下所示:

^{pr2}$

现在,当我在我的项目上运行syncdb时,我希望两个模型都能生成一个mysql表,但是MyModel是唯一一个创建为MyModel_MyModel的表。我不知道如何让syncdb创建另一个模型,因为我希望得到另一个名为mymodel_myothermodel的表。在

谢谢你的帮助, 马蒂亚斯


Tags: 文件项目djangopy模型文件夹modelinit

热门问题